Why Roofing Materials Matter in Earthquake Safety
During an earthquake, the roof’s weight and flexibility play a vital role in how a building responds to seismic forces.
Heavy roofs (clay/concrete tiles): Increase top-load stress, raising the risk of collapse.
Rigid materials (slate/stone): Crack or fall easily under vibrations.
Lightweight flexible materials (shingles): Absorb shock and distribute stress more evenly.

Best Roofing Shingle Materials for Earthquake-Resistant Homes
1. Asphalt Shingles
Lightweight compared to clay or concrete.
High flexibility allows them to withstand vibrations without cracking.
Affordable and easy to install in both urban and rural housing.

2. Architectural Shingles
Thicker and more durable than 3-tab shingles.
Provide extra adhesion and wind resistance, preventing displacement during tremors.
Suitable for multi-storey earthquake-resistant residences.

3. Fiberglass Shingles
Built with fiberglass mats, making them stronger yet lighter than organic-based shingles.
Highly fire-resistant (important in quake aftermaths where fires may occur).
Long-lasting with minimal maintenance.
4. Composite Roofing Shingles
Made from a mix of polymer, asphalt, and recycled materials.
Offer maximum flexibility, resisting cracks under shifting structures.
Eco-friendly, making them ideal for sustainable earthquake-safe housing.
5. Solar Roofing Shingles
Dual-purpose: generate electricity while reducing top roof weight compared to heavy solar panels.
Integrated design ensures secure installation, less prone to dislodging during tremors.
